Backhoe Service in Atlanta, GA
Backhoe service involves the use of a versatile piece of heavy equipment equipped with a large digging bucket, used for excavation, grading, and material removal. Homeowners often request backhoe services for projects such as digging foundations, installing septic systems, landscaping, trenching for utilities, or removing debris and soil. Understanding the scope of the project, the type of soil or material to be moved, and the size of the area helps property owners determine if backhoe services are suitable for their needs.
Before requesting backhoe service, property owners should consider the project size and location, as well as any access restrictions on the property. Clarifying the specific tasks, such as digging, lifting, or grading, can ensure the right equipment and approach are used. It’s also helpful to understand any permits or regulations that may apply to excavation work in the area, ensuring the project proceeds smoothly and in compliance with local requirements.

Excavation And Site Preparation
Backhoe services are essential for clearing land, leveling surfaces, and preparing properties for construction or landscaping projects.
Landscaping And Grading
Backhoes help shape the terrain, create drainage solutions, and install features like retaining walls around properties in atlanta, ga.
Utility And Drainage Installation
Backhoe services assist with laying pipes, installing septic systems, and managing underground utility work for residential and commercial sites.

Common Backhoe Service Jobs
Land Clearing - preparing land for construction, landscaping, or farming projects.
Excavation - digging trenches, foundations, or holes for various home improvements.
Driveway Installation - grading and laying out new driveways for better access and curb appeal.
Drainage Work - installing or repairing drainage systems to prevent water accumulation.
Fence Post Installation - digging holes for fences and property boundaries.
Site Grading - leveling and contouring land to ensure proper drainage and stability.
Backhoe Service Questions
What types of projects benefit from backhoe services? Backhoe services are suitable for excavating foundations, trenching for utilities, landscaping, and removing debris on residential and commercial properties.
How deep can a backhoe dig? Backhoes can typically dig up to 15 to 20 feet deep, depending on the model and project requirements.
Is backhoe service appropriate for small-scale jobs? Yes, backhoes are versatile and can handle both large and small projects efficiently, including yard work and minor excavation tasks.
What should property owners consider before scheduling backhoe service? It's important to assess access to the site, the type of soil, and the scope of the work to ensure the right equipment and approach are used.
